Essential Ingredients

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Graham Cracker Crust: A buttery graham cracker crust adds the perfect crunch to balance the creamy filling.
  • Cream Cheese: Use full-fat cream cheese for a rich and smooth base that sets beautifully.
  • Sugar: Granulated sugar sweetens the filling while enhancing the overall flavor of the cheesecake.
  • Eggs: These help bind everything together; room temperature eggs mix more easily into the batter.
  • Sour Cream: Adds tanginess while keeping the cheesecake moist and creamy.
  • Caramel Sauce: Store-bought or homemade, it drizzles beautifully over the top and enhances every bite.
  • Apples: Use tart varieties like Granny Smith for contrast against the sweetness of the caramel.
  • Cinnamon and Nutmeg: These spices bring warmth and depth to your apple mixture, making it irresistible.
  • Vanilla Extract: A splash adds aromatic sweetness that complements all other flavors perfectly.

Let’s Make it Together

Create Your Graham Cracker Crust: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). In a bowl, combine crushed graham crackers with melted butter until well mixed. Press this mixture firmly into the bottom of a springform pan.

Prepare Your Creamy Filling: In another large bowl, beat softened cream cheese until smooth. Gradually add sugar and continue mixing until fully combined without lumps.

Add Eggs One by One: Incorporate eggs one at a time into your cream cheese mixture, ensuring each egg is fully integrated before adding the next.

Mix in Sour Cream and Spices: Stir in sour cream along with vanilla extract, ground cinnamon, and nutmeg until everything is blended harmoniously into creamy perfection.

Add Apples & Pour Mixture into Pan: Fold diced apples gently into your batter. Pour this heavenly mixture over your prepped graham cracker crust evenly.

Bake Your Cheesecake to Perfection: Place your cake in the oven and bake for 50-60 minutes until set but slightly jiggly in the center. Turn off the oven and leave it inside for 1 hour before cooling completely at room temperature.

Chef's Helpful Tips

  • Use room temperature ingredients for a smoother cheesecake batter and avoid lumps
  • Don’t overmix once you add eggs; this helps prevent cracks during baking
  • Let your cheesecake cool gradually to minimize cracking on the surface

What can I substitute for cream cheese?

Mascarpone cheese works well as a rich and creamy alternative.

Can I make this cheesecake ahead of time?

Absolutely! It stores well in the fridge for several days before serving.

How do I prevent cracks in my cheesecake?

Gradually cool your cheesecake and avoid overmixing after adding eggs to minimize cracks.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 ½ cups graham cracker crumbs
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 16 oz full-fat c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 3 large eggs (room temperature)
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• ½ cup caramel sauce (store-bought or homemade)
  • 2 cups diced Granny Smith apples (about 2 medium apples)
  • 1 tsp ground cinnamon
  • ½ tsp ground nutmeg
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). In a bowl, combine graham cracker crumbs and melted butter. Press into the bottom of a springform pan.
  2. Beat cream cheese until smooth in a large bowl. Gradually add sugar until combined.
  3. Mix in eggs one at a time, ensuring each is fully integrated before adding the next.
  4. Stir in sour cream,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and nutmeg until well blended.
  5. Gently fold in diced apples. Pour mixture over the crust evenly.
  6. Bake for 50-60 minutes until set but slightly jiggly in the center. Turn off the oven and let it cool inside for an hour before cooling to room temperature.
  7. Chill overnight in the fridge if possible and drizzle with caramel sauce before serving.
